T26/27 MIDDLE SCHOOL ASSISTANT PRINCIPAL (CANDIDATE POOL)

Arlington Public SchoolsArlington, VA
Onsite

About The Position

This job posting has been created to build and maintain a pool of qualified candidates. The Middle School Assistant Principal assists the principal in administering and supervising the total middle school program, providing instructional leadership, supporting staff and student development, and ensuring a safe, inclusive, and effective learning environment. The Middle School Assistant Principal supports the principal in administering the instructional programs for the school and is a member of the team responsible for providing instructional leadership. The work involves responsibilities, as assigned, for developing and implementing a sound instructional program, supervising, and evaluating the performance of staff members, maintaining the school plant facility, and serving as a liaison between the school and the community. The purpose of the work is to promote continuous improvement and student achievement by ensuring high-quality educational programs, effective school management, and a positive, collaborative school culture. The impact of the work benefits students, staff, families, and the community by fostering instructional excellence, supporting professional growth, and maintaining an organized, safe, and inclusive learning environment.

Requirements

  • Demonstrates thorough knowledge of modern public middle school education principles, practices, and current trends, and applies them effectively to meet the needs of the school community.
  • Possesses knowledge of curriculum design, instructional strategies, assessment methods, and school improvement planning processes.
  • Understands school administrative practices, student services operations, and overall school management functions.
  • Plans, organizes, and coordinates programs, activities, and personnel efficiently to support instructional and operational goals.
  • Exhibits strong leadership, communication, and interpersonal skills to inspire and guide staff and students toward continuous improvement.
  • Builds and sustains positive relationships with students, families, staff, and community partners to promote collaboration and engagement.
  • Analyzes problems, identifies solutions, and makes sound decisions using effective judgment and conflict resolution strategies.
  • Models professionalism, ethical behavior, integrity, and cultural competence in all interactions and decisions.
  • Communicates clearly and effectively, both orally and in writing, to diverse audiences.
  • Master’s degree in education, school administration or educational leadership.
  • A minimum of (four) 4 years of experience in teaching, preferably at the high school level.
  • Demonstrated experience in educational leadership, supervision, or administrative capacity.
  • Postgraduate Professional License with endorsement(s) designated as appropriate to the assignment.
  • Must have or be eligible for licensure in the state of Virginia.
  • Administrative and supervision PreK-12 endorsement.

Responsibilities

  • Assists in the administration and supervision of the total middle school program, including academic, co-curricular, and extracurricular activities.
  • Provides instructional leadership to ensure high-quality teaching and learning aligned with Arlington Public Schools’ mission, goals, and Virginia Standards of Learning.
  • Supervises and evaluates instructional and support personnel, providing feedback and professional development opportunities to enhance staff performance and instructional effectiveness.
  • Upholds effective student discipline and promotes a safe, inclusive, and supportive school climate conducive to learning.
  • Monitors student attendance, grading, counseling, and pupil services programs to ensure equitable access and consistent implementation.
  • Participate in the development, implementation, and evaluation of school improvement and instructional programs.
  • Coordinate operational and support service activities, including transportation, safety, facility maintenance, field trips, and community use of the building.
  • Oversees compliance with emergency procedures, safety drills, and established security protocols to ensure the safety of students, staff, and visitors.
  • Assists in managing budget and fiscal procedures; prepares reports, forms, surveys, and maintains accurate records and inventories.
  • Serves as liaison between the school, families, and community organizations to foster effective communication, engagement, and support for student success.
  • Participates in staff selection, induction, supervision, and retention processes; makes recommendations regarding hiring, reassignment, and termination of personnel.
  • Plans, supervises, and participates in school events, assemblies, professional development activities, and orientation programs for students, staff, and parents.
  • Assists in the supervision of custodial and security staff to promote a clean, safe, and orderly learning environment.
  • Develops and supervises assigned instructional programs or curriculum areas to ensure alignment with division standards and goals.
  • Attends professional meetings, workshops, and conferences to maintain knowledge of current educational practices and trends.
  • Serves as the acting administrator in the principal’s absence.
  • Performs other administrative, instructional, and operational duties as assigned to support school leadership, staff development, and student achievement.
